LongStream concat() 方法在 Java 中


LongStream 類中的 concat() 方法建立一個連線流,其元素由第一個流中的所有元素及後面第二個流中的所有元素組成。

語法如下。

static LongStream concat(LongStream one, LongStream two)

這裡,引數 one 是第一個流,而 two 是第二個流。該方法返回這兩個流的連線。

若要在 Java 中使用 LongStream 類,請匯入以下程式包。

import java.util.stream.LongStream;

建立一個 LongStream 並新增一些元素。

LongStream streamOne = LongStream.of(100L, 150L, 300L, 500L);

現在,建立一個另一個流。

LongStream streamTwo = LongStream.of(200L, 250L, 400L, 600L, 550L);

要連線以上兩個流,請使用 concat() 方法。

LongStream.concat(streamOne, streamTwo)

以下是一個在 Java 中實現 LongStream concat() 方法的示例。

示例

 線上演示

import java.util.stream.LongStream;
import java.util.stream.Stream;
public class Demo {
   public static void main(String[] args) {
      LongStream streamOne = LongStream.of(100L, 150L, 300L, 500L);
      LongStream streamTwo = LongStream.of(200L, 250L, 400L, 600L, 550L);
      System.out.println("Result of the Concatenated Streams...");
      LongStream.concat(streamOne, streamTwo).forEach(a -> System.out.println(a));
   }
}

輸出

Result of the Concatenated Streams...
100
150
300
500
200
250
400
600
550

更新於: 2019 年 7 月 30 日

73 次檢視

開啟你的 職業生涯

完成課程並獲得認證

開始
廣告
© . All rights reserved.